WebThe breaker points (called "Contact breaker" in the figure) are an electrical switch opened and closed by a cam on the distributor shaft. This is timed so the points are closed for the majority of the engine cycle, allowing current to flow through the ignition coil, and are opened momentarily when a spark is desired. The contact breaker is regulated by the cam, and when the … uki agility eventsWebPrimary voltage guidelines at the positive terminal of a breaker-point coil were: Key on and the points open: system voltage (open-circuit voltage, remember). Key on and the points closed: 5 to 7 volts (voltage is dropped by the ballast resistor).
